FamilyFABACEAE
Genus speciesAstragalus munroi Benth. ex Bunge sect. Lithophilus
SynonymsAstragalus longicalyx C.C.Ni & P.C.Li
Habitatgrassland and rocks
Altitude3000-5200m
Descriptionstems densely white hirsute, leaflets 19-21 pairs, oblanceolate, obtuse, flowers in dense head, sepals linear-aristate, corolla 25mm long
Size30-70cm
Colorpale yellow
Bloomsummer
Ca
Typesubshrub
Cultivationrock crevices with favourable water regime, eastern slopes
alpine house, poor, drained soil, shading in summer
Propagationscarified seed in spring, germ. 1-3 months, 10-13°C
cuttings in late summer
Territory Asia-Temperate
     China (Tibet , Xinjiang )
Asia-Tropical
     Indian Subcontinent (Pakistan , West Himalaya)
